TL;DR
AI image generators are rapidly automating the visual execution side of fashion design, turning sketching and technical drawings into prompt engineering. However, the core creative vision - understanding why humans will want to wear something six months from now - remains deeply human territory that requires cultural intuition AI doesn't possess.
